Output d95456a52b2a7dba3bde08b98e73c7660325ff1b8328cdfd3b5a751afd91db65:1

value
668687
script pubkey
OP_0 OP_PUSHBYTES_20 c525375d21404cae9a60a43f8577140737ac08f4
address
bc1qc5jnwhfpgpx2axnq5slc2ac5qum6cz85sjp96y
transaction
d95456a52b2a7dba3bde08b98e73c7660325ff1b8328cdfd3b5a751afd91db65
confirmations
152277
spent
true